Can you fry fries in chicken grease?

Contents show

I have researched the best way to do this while keeping the fries in tip-top shape. You can fry chicken and French fries in the same oil, but it is best to cook the fries first and then fry the chicken. The fries may leave an aftertaste of chicken, especially if seasoned before frying.

What is the best grease to fry French fries in?

Refined peanut oil is the best oil for making French fries. Canola or safflower oil can also be used. In addition, restaurant French fries are very crispy due to the continuous use of old oil, among other things.

What oil does Mcdonald’s use for fries?

The supplier we work with first peels, cuts, and blanches the potatoes. Then they dry the fries, partially fry them, and flash freeze the fries for restaurant use. Once in the kitchen, they are cooked in canola blend oil so they are crispy hot and ready to serve any way you like.

Can I reuse oil after frying chicken?

Cooking oil can be reused after frying raw chicken, vegetables, or batter. Allow the oil to cool. Then scoop out any remaining food or fried food. Drain the cooled oil from the fryer, strain the used oil, and store it in a resealable container for later use.

How many times can I reuse frying oil?

Recommendation: For breaded foods, reuse oil 3-4 times. For clean oil frying, such as potato chips, it is safe to reuse the oil at least 8 times. It may take longer than that, especially if you are refilling with fresh oil.

Do you have to refrigerate used frying oil?

Why? Lack of light is important, but very cold temperatures are most effective in mitigating oxidation and peroxide production. This is the source of the unpleasant taste and odor of oxidized oils. Therefore, super-cooling the oil and storing it in a dark freezer is the best bet for keeping it fresh.

Can you pour oil down the drain?

There is no disposal of cooking oil. Do not pour oil down drains or toilets. It can clog city sewer mains as well as pipes. Also, do not add oil to septic systems. It will clog the pipes and, even worse, the distribution lines and drains.

Why Soak potatoes before making french fries?

According to Nasr, the secret to the crispy texture of French fries is soaking. The starch is drawn out, making them firmer and less likely to stick together. The cook fries them twice. First in peanut oil heated to 325 degrees until slightly softened, then again in oil at 375 degrees until crispy and browned.

What oil do restaurants use to fry?

Most deep fryers operate at temperatures of 350 to 400 degrees Fahrenheit, making canola oil a very stable choice. Additionally, canola oil tends to be one of the most affordable oils on the market, making it a popular choice for restaurants that require large quantities of oil and frequent oil changes.
